State Pen Porter

Brewery: Santa Fe Brewing Company

Alcohol By Volume: 6.40%

Beer Style: Porter

Availability: Year Round

Description:

A trademark beer of the Santa Fe Brewing Company’s master brewer, Ty Levis, the State Pen Porter has every reason to be one of his favorites. It is flavorful, swimming with notes of nuts and chocolate; it is drinkable, so drinkable that it is almost as if pint after pint were drinking itself.

Appearance - 4.0

Pours an inch of light brown head into a standard pint glass. The head has great retention and leaves some nice globs of lace. The beer is a mostly opaque dark brown.

Aroma - 3.5

The aroma is nice and pungent. There are some roasted malts, a nuttiness and light chocolate present. There's also a subtle hop presence.

Mouthfeel - 3.0

Light in body with good carbonation. The body is bit too thin for the style.

Taste - 3.0

The flavor is similar to the nose, but a bit boring. You get the roasted malt up front followed by the nuttiness and ending with chocolate paired with some bittering hops.

Overall - 3.0

Starts out good from the look and smell, but it becomes a bit mediocre when it comes to the taste and mouth feel. An OK beer, but nothing to write home about.
